What steps will reproduce the problem?
1. Fire up a terminal (I used urxvt)
2. Install enlightenment
3. Try to type enlightenment_start
4. Try to erase the line with ^u
What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
Typing enlightenment_start creates the string enlightenmentt_start, with no way
to type the t without typing another t. I was able to try enlightenment_start
by tab completing, but if it had not been for my tab key, I would still be
wondering if enlightenment can run here.
Similarly, typing ctrl+u to kill the line always repeated whatever character I
typed before pressing ctrl. The ctrl did not register, I might have had better
luck with Esc+U but I didn't try it.
What version of the product are you using? On what operating system?
1.03 on Transformer TF-101 with JellyBean 4.2 (EOS4) Nightly 92
Please provide any additional information below.
The terminal is very slow to paint with anti-aliased fonts. I did not try
other fonts, there are too many problems to consider using this ongoing in its
current state. It seems though far superior to running X11vnc and accessing it
through AndroidVNC client. Kudos.
